Address Overview

Address

f3sd6c6cnz4ocrwimdxyzu2kyxtocaicml273ih6kvsjp7p4novj3mzlasztpktuovdd6hh5zclyis7cnmu5pa

ID

f01323639

Actor

Account

Balance

392.59059403568395 FIL

Messages

478

Create Time

2021-10-01 15:05:30

Latest Transaction

2024-08-30 16:25:00

Account Change
24 hour